Ukraine Introduces Online Compensation for Utility Costs for Evacuation Centers

The Ukrainian government has approved a new procedure to provide financial compensation for utility expenses incurred by owners and tenants of evacuation centers for internally displaced persons. Applications for these payments can now be submitted online, with funds disbursed monthly by the 25th.

Prime Minister Yulia Svyrydenko announced that the compensation will cover costs associated with essential services, including heating, water, electricity, as well as expenses for liquefied gas and both solid and liquid household fuels.

Individuals can apply for compensation through their personal accounts on the Pension Fund’s electronic services portal. The National Social Services Agency and its regional offices will oversee the distribution of these funds, ensuring proper allocation.

“The state continues to systematically support those who have been forced to leave their homes, as well as those providing them with temporary shelter,” Svyrydenko stated.
